1. Introduction to Casino Industry
Casinos, establishments that offer a variety of games of chance, have been around for centuries. With the rise of modern technology, the casino industry has expanded exponentially. Today, casinos are found in various locations, including Las Vegas, Macau, and Atlantic City. The industry generates billions of dollars in revenue annually, making it one of the most profitable sectors in the entertainment industry.

3. Factors Influencing Casino Earnings
Several factors can influence casino earnings, including location, market demand, competition, economic conditions, and government regulations.
3.1 Location
The location of a casino can significantly impact its revenue. Casinos located in tourist destinations, such as Las Vegas and Macau, often enjoy higher revenue than those in less popular areas. Additionally, casinos in densely populated areas may have more potential customers, leading to increased earnings.
3.2 Market Demand
Market demand plays a crucial role in determining casino earnings. If there is high demand for gambling in a particular area, casinos may experience increased revenue. Conversely, if demand is low, casinos may struggle to generate significant income.
3.3 Competition
Competition among casinos can impact earnings. In areas with a high number of casinos, competition may lead to price wars, reduced profit margins, and decreased revenue. However, competition can also drive innovation and improve the overall experience for players.
3.4 Economic Conditions
Economic conditions, such as unemployment rates, inflation, and consumer confidence, can influence casino earnings. During economic downturns, people may be more cautious with their spending, leading to decreased casino revenue. Conversely, during economic booms, people may be more willing to spend on entertainment, resulting in higher casino earnings.
3.5 Government Regulations
Government regulations can significantly impact the casino industry. High taxes, strict regulations, and restrictions on advertising can all contribute to decreased revenue. However, some regulations, such as age restrictions and anti-money laundering measures, can help ensure the industry's integrity and sustainability.
